Joel Osteen Devotional 18th May 2025 (Sunday) TOPIC: Get Back Up

TODAY’S SCRIPTURE
Though a righteous man falls seven times, he will get up.
Proverbs 24:16, HCSB

TODAY’S WORD
You may have plenty of reasons to give up when you think your dream is never going to work out. You’ve had disappointments and setbacks. It’s gotten so the tough days are far more than the good days. The excitement is gone. That’s all a part of the process. When you get knocked down, you have to get back up again. God didn’t bring you this far to leave you. Don’t settle for mediocrity. God created you for greatness.

There’s something in you that will cause you to stand out. You have something that nobody else has or can do. God put the seed in you so you can leave your mark. Don’t let people talk you out of it. Don’t let failures convince you to give up. Don’t let delays and detours cause you to get discouraged. You’re not weak or lacking. You are full of can-do power. When you stay committed, when you keep being your best day in and day out, God will open doors you could never open. He has something more rewarding for you than you’ve ever imagined.

PRAYER FOR TODAY
“Father, thank You that You have given me can-do power to tap into in order to overcome whatever is coming against me. Thank You for sustaining faith that takes me through the challenges and setbacks. I will keep getting back up until the victory is mine. In Jesus’ Name, Amen.”
